North Carolina Forest Development Act

A voluntary cost sharing program to “provide financial assistance to eligible landowners to increase the productivity of the privately-owned forests of the State.” Along with Legislative appropriations (often $589,500/year), this framework provides funding for reforestation and forest improvement work cost shared under the Forest Development Program. This partnership to improve reforestation rates and provide for a long-term supply of timber is a shared goal and responsibility between the State and forest industry.
